**EchoPulse: Adaptive Symbolic Key Encapsulation Framework for Cybersecurity, Embedded Defense Systems, and Post-Quantum Resilience**

Authors: Wartenberg, Tom;

**EchoPulse: Adaptive Symbolic Key Encapsulation Framework for Cybersecurity, Embedded Defense Systems, and Post-Quantum Resilience**

Abstract

EchoPulse: Adaptive Symbolic Key Encapsulation Framework (v1–v3 Public Release) The EchoPulse series represents a sovereign adaptive key encapsulation mechanism (KEM) developed for post-quantum cryptography, embedded defense systems, and sovereign infrastructure security. Across versions 1 to 3, EchoPulse systematically evolved from initial symbolic-state KEM architectures into a fully integrated sovereign PQC asset, optimized for defense-level deployments. Unlike classical algebraic KEMs, EchoPulse implements deterministic symbolic-state transitions over finite symbolic graphs (GV-L) combined with advanced side-channel protection, mutation-based key derivation, and hardware-optimized execution paths for constrained embedded devices. The framework is fully implemented in Rust, tested across multiple microcontroller architectures (ARM Cortex M0–M4, RISC-V), and designed for sovereign supply chain control. EchoPulse is a symbolic key encapsulation mechanism designed for post-quantum cryptography. It combines deterministic graph transitions, per-session mutation, and symbol-path validation to enable secure communication under low-resource constraints.
